About Our Team

LexisNexis Legal & Professional, which serves customers in more than 150 countries with 11,800 employees worldwide, is part of RELX (http://www.relx.com), a global provider of information-based analytics and decision tools for professional and business customers. Our company has been a long-time leader in deploying AI and advanced technologies to the legal market to improve productivity and transform the overall business and practice of law, deploying ethical and powerful generative AI solutions with a flexible, multi-model approach that prioritizes using the best model from today’s top model creators for each individual legal use case. The company employs over 2,000 technologists, data scientists, and experts to develop, test, and validate solutions in line with RELX Responsible AI Principles (https://stories.relx.com/responsible-ai-principles/index.html).

About The Role

We are looking for an innovative AI Content Optimization Lead to drive AI ideation and workflow integration across Practical Guidance content within Global Editorial Operations. In this role, you will identify opportunities to enhance content creation through AI technologies, partnering with global stakeholders to deliver scalable solutions that improve quality, efficiency, and impact.

Responsibilities

  • Identify and evaluate opportunities to apply AI and automation to streamline and enhance existing editorial workflows, driving efficiency, scalability, and quality across global content operations
  • Support the development and execution of strategies for AI-assisted Practical Guidance workflows, ensuring alignment with business goals and market demands
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including commercial, product management, engineering, business analysts, subject matter experts, and project management to prioritize opportunities and execute on AI content optimization from ideation to deployment on a global scale
  • Oversee the integration of AI solutions for global deployment across North America, UK, and Asia-Pacific, ensuring seamless integration into workflows, tools, and platforms
  • Communicate progress and outcomes to internal teams, senior leadership, and key stakeholders, using data to provide clear insights and support decision-making
  • Stay informed of industry trends, emerging technologies, competitive intelligence, and best practices in AI and content generation, with a focus on global applications

Requirements

  • Experience in content/publishing, project management, or product development
  • Extensive experience in legal content preferred
  • Experience utilizing AI/automation in content optimization
  • Proven track record of leading or contributing to cross-functional teams and delivering complex projects on time and within budget, preferably in a global context
  • Familiarity with AI technologies, such as large language models (LLMs), natural language processing (NLP) techniques, and machine learning applications; experience utilizing AI/automation in content optimization preferred
  • Highly proficient in data analysis and performance metrics, with the ability to report insights and progress to stakeholders
  •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across departments and global teams
  • Strategic thinker with a passion for innovation and a results-driven mindset
  • Legal degree (JD) preferred

About The Business

LexisNexis Legal & Professional® provides legal, regulatory, and business information and analytics that help customers increase their productivity, improve decision-making, achieve better outcomes, and advance the rule of law around the world. As a digital pioneer, the company was the first to bring legal and business information online with its Lexis® and Nexis® services.
